adventures of freddoKiwi kids wanting to go adventuring these school holidays don't have to stray far from home - the Adventures of Freddo website lets children learn new skills online.

"The Adventures of Freddo" at www.freddo.co.nz are a series of interactive stories and games designed to simultaneously entertain and educate children.

Developed under the theme of edu-tainment, The Adventures of Freddo tap into Freddo's love of storytelling combined with adventure, modern teaching approaches and interactivity.

Cadbury New Zealand Brand Manager Natasha Bell says The Adventures of Freddo has been developed as a way to use Freddo's heroic and adventurous character to entertain children while at the same time teaching them new skills.

"Parents understand the importance of children learning online, but they're wary of websites which are either unsuitable or cost money," Bell says.

"The Adventures of Freddo is a free website which aims to educate and entertain children in the digital environment – a media this generation is very familiar and comfortable with – using a more modern version of the cheeky, lovable Freddo frog.

"We have engaged teachers, child psychologists and educational experts to help bring this experience to life.

"We've also consulted with parents to include innovative features such as accommodating the way children learn online and ensuring they don't spend too long in front of the computer by sending them into the 'real world' to help Freddo by completing off-line tasks," Bell says.

The Adventures Of Freddo are set over 10 episodes – the first is called 'The Secret of the Golden Keys'. The adventures involve Freddo and his friends Ashley, Hannah and Zac setting off on a quest through time to play games, solve puzzles, save their teacher Professor Jeffery and outsmart the evil toad Gorf.
